The Futurist Cookbook

"The Futurist Cookbook," created by Italian artist and writer Filippo Tommaso Marinetti in 1932, is a provocative collection blending culinary recipes with artistic and political ideas from the Futurist movement. It challenges traditional notions of cuisine, emphasizing speed, innovation, and modernity while reflecting the era's fascination with technology, dynamism, and breaking conventions. The book uses imaginative, often surreal instructions to provoke thought about how society and culture could evolve with progress and artistic experimentation. Overall, it’s both an artistic manifesto and a conceptual work that blurs boundaries between food, art, and societal change.
